

This antique was found in Old Towne Carmel. Originally it burned
coal but later had a conversion burner added. The burner was held in
place only by the gas line. A humidifier above the burner leaked all
over it. The tenant called for no heat as the blower motor had failed.
We found that flames shot out the front when it lit and flue gases
spilled out the top inspection door. The landlord had us replace it. The
heat exchanger had to be smashed apart with a sledgehammer. It was too
heavy to come out in 1 piece!

The modern replacement. This 80% efficient unit heats the house very
quickly, has good airflow to all of the rooms and will save a bundle on gas
bills! To vent properly in the oversized chimney, a metal liner was installed in
the chimney for the furnace & water heater to use.
